alecpl
2010-02-13 48bc52e835bd5485f7443d54399e4fb0d36732d7
program/steps/mail/func.inc
@@ -24,9 +24,6 @@
// actions that do not require imap connection
$NOIMAP_ACTIONS = array('spell', 'addcontact', 'autocomplete', 'upload', 'display-attachment', 'remove-attachment');
// Init IMAP object
$RCMAIL->imap_init();
// log in to imap server
if (!in_array($RCMAIL->action, $NOIMAP_ACTIONS) && !$RCMAIL->imap_connect()) {
  $RCMAIL->kill_session();
@@ -42,7 +39,7 @@
// set imap properties and session vars
if ($mbox = get_input_value('_mbox', RCUBE_INPUT_GPC))
  $IMAP->set_mailbox(($_SESSION['mbox'] = $mbox));
else
else if ($IMAP)
  $_SESSION['mbox'] = $IMAP->get_mailbox_name();
if (!empty($_GET['_page']))